What’s Bremerhaven Like in September?

September in Bremerhaven typically offers a pleasant transition from summer to autumn with mild weather. Average daytime temperatures usually range from approximately 15°C to 19°C (59°F to 66°F), while evenings can cool down to around 9°C to 12°C (48°F to 54°F). Visitors can expect an estimated 5-6 hours of sunshine per day. Rainfall is moderate, with around 8-10 rainy days throughout the month and total precipitation averaging 60-70mm. It’s advisable to pack layers and a waterproof jacket for comfort.

What Are Typical Costs and Availability in September?

Accommodation availability in September is generally good, as it’s outside the peak summer holiday season, yet still popular due to pleasant weather. Estimated hotel prices for a mid-range room might range from €90 to €160 per night. Budget options, like guesthouses or hostels, could start from approximately €55 to €85. Dining out at a casual restaurant might cost €12-€25 per person (estimate), while a mid-range meal could be €30-€45 (estimate). Public transportation, such as a single bus ticket, is typically around €2.80-€3.50 (estimate).

What Can I Expect Regarding Crowds and Events?

September sees moderate crowd levels in Bremerhaven. While still attracting tourists due to agreeable weather, it’s generally less busy than the peak summer months of July and August. Weekends, however, might experience a slight increase in visitors. Specific large-scale events can vary annually; however, the month sometimes features local markets or smaller cultural festivals. Conditions are generally good for exploring, with comfortable temperatures, though occasional rain showers are possible.

What Are the Best Activities for September?

September is ideal for exploring both indoor and outdoor attractions. Highly recommended activities include visiting the Klimahaus 8° Ost, the German Maritime Museum (Deutsches Schifffahrtsmuseum), and the U-Boot Wilhelm Bauer submarine, all offering engaging indoor experiences. Stroll through the Havenwelten area, enjoy the fresh air along the Weser Promenade, or take a harbor tour to see the city from the water. The Zoo am Meer is also enjoyable in the mild September weather.
